only played with harimoto zlc variant. Can compare with outer alc. Inner zlc is less punchy. More power from backcourt. Spinnier but higher arc. Alc is easier to 冲 (fast loop). alc better for service as it is faster good for long spinny serve.any differences in speed, dwell time, and composition?

There's a difference between stiffness and hardness. Ayous is light and soft but stiff, koto is hard but not stiff, it lets vibrations through and gives feedback. Essentially stiffness is dampening and hardness is, well, hardness...What do you mean with stiffer ayous?
